Chilicolletes

Taxonomy ID: 405777 (for references in articles please use NCBI:txid405777)
current name
Chilicolletes
NCBI BLAST name: bees
Rank: genus
Genetic code: Translation table 1 (Standard)
Mitochondrial genetic code: Translation table 5 (Invertebrate Mitochondrial)
Other names:
heterotypic synonym
Leioproctes (Chilicolletes)
Lineage( full )
cellular organisms; Eukaryota; Opisthokonta; Metazoa; Eumetazoa; Bilateria; Protostomia; Ecdysozoa; Panarthropoda; Arthropoda; Mandibulata; Pancrustacea; Hexapoda; Insecta; Dicondylia; Pterygota; Neoptera; Endopterygota; Hymenoptera; Apocrita; Aculeata; Apoidea; Anthophila; Colletidae; Paracolletinae
